Massimo Ambrosini has suggested that Igli Tare will be used as a scapegoat by AC Milan, despite the fact that he deserves the smallest share of blame.
Tare was announced by Milan at the start of last summer, taking on the role of sporting director, and there was enthusiasm over the Rossoneri finally having an experienced director. However, the outcome of the 2025 summer business was far from ideal, with most expensive players struggling.

As such, the former Lazio director is now expected to leave the club at the end of the season. He might not be the only one to depart the club management, but he will be the first. As argued by the Milan legend Ambrosini (via MilanPress), he can be likened to a scapegoat.
“After the match against Lazio, Milan gave up psychologically: that’s a fact. Whether it was caused by a lack of motivation or something else, I don’t know, but what’s filtering through speaks of a situation that can’t continue like this.
“The perception is that something has happened. Now, it’s impossible to think that, even with the result achieved, Cardinale won’t take charge of Milan’s situation. He has to do it.
“Of all the figures involved, I think Igli Tare is the one to blame the least, but, in my opinion, he will be the one who pays the price,” he stated on the podcast Cronache di Spogliatoio.
It remains to be seen if we will ever get to the bottom of which director pushed for which players last summer, as that is a pretty important part of the story. If it turns out Tare was against Christopher Nkunku, for example, that would put things in a different light…
